Rafa Marquez’s debut: NY Red Bulls 0 LA Galaxy 1


The LA Galaxy won bragging rights as they beat the NY Red Bulls, 1-0.
Edson Buddle was put through by a nice pass by Juninho and the Galaxy striker made no mistake. Juan Pablo Angel came close to restoring parity on a couple of different occasions. His free kick missed by a whisker and then his header from a swerving free kick by Rafa Marquez clanged off the crossbar.
Thierry Henry showed some nice foot skills and a quick eye for a pass but his finishing let him down- he looks a few knots slower than his Barca days. His big moment came when he raced after the ball with Donovan Ricketts also come charging out from goal – the French striker tried going to the right but Ricketts with a sliding challenge was able to cut him off.
The Red Bulls came close again with Ricketts saving Angel’s header off Lindpere’s cross and off the rebound Tim Ream smashes it but it deflected off Berhalter for a corner. Buddle came close again in the final minutes with Bouna Condoul stretched out to make a finger tips save off his stinging grounder.
